在Python中,writerow方法是csv模块中的一个函数,用于将一行数据写入CSV文件。它的作用是将给定的数据按照指定的格式写入CSV文件的一行中,并在每个数据项之间添加逗号作为分隔符。 具体来说,writerow方法接受一个可迭代对象作为参数,该可迭代对象包含要写入CSV文件的数据项。它会自动将每个数据项转换为字符串,并将它们...
dw.writeheader() # writerow每次写入一行 dw.writerow(dict1) # writerows多行写入 dw.writerows([dict2, dict3, dict4, dict5]) 77. python writerows写入多行mp.weixin.qq.com/s?__biz=MzI2MzE1NTg2OA==&mid=2649776608&idx=1&sn=7dbcd49857fb356f3bd0d1c5041dda25&chksm=f244f813c533710...
writerow():单行写入,将一个列表全部写入csv的同一行 writerows():多行写入,将一个二维列表的每一个列表写为一行 例子: name=[(“src_ip”,“dst_ip”,“src_port”,“dst_port”,“ul_pkts”,“dl_pkts”,“ul_flag”,“dl_flag”)] 使用writer.writerow(name),得到结果: “(‘src_ip’, ‘dst...
如果在使用csv.writer时没有正确设置newline=''(在Python 3中尤其重要),也可能导致在Windows系统上出现空行问题,因为Windows系统使用\r\n作为换行符,而Python的csv.writer默认会使用系统的换行符,但同时又可能在写入时额外添加一个换行符。 二、解决方案 1. 确保正确的newline参数 在打开文件时,确保为open函数指定...
python writerow函数 python中的write函数 Python os.write()方法 概述 os.write() 方法用于写入字符串到文件描述符 fd 中. 返回实际写入的字符串长度。 在Unix中有效。 语法 write()方法语法格式如下: os.write(fd,str) 参数fd -- 文件描述符。
python3 writerow CSV文件多一个空行 1 2 3 5 6 7 8 #coding=utf-8 importcsv fp=open('C:/Users/93794/Desktop/test.csv','w+') writer=csv.writer(fp) writer.writerow(('id','name')) writer.writerow(('1','xiaoming')) writer.writerow(('2','张三'))...
self.index += 1 2.打开方式加newline='' 空字符 with open(self.game_name + '2022.csv', 'w', encoding='utf-8-sig', newline='') as f: writer = csv.writer(f) #将dialect设置为unix,换行符即为'\n' writer.writerow(self.bilibili_columns) for line in self.data: writer.writerow(...
在Python中,可以使用`csv`模块来处理CSV文件。要合并不同列的多个CSV文件,可以使用`csv.writer`的`writerow`方法。 下面是一个示例代码,演示如何使用`writero...
writer = csv.writer(csvfile)#先写入columns_namewriter.writerow(["index","a_name","b_name"])#写入多行用writerowswriter.writerows([[0,1,3],[1,2,3],[2,3,4]]) 加入newline='' 参数 #coding=utf-8importcsv#python2可以用file替代openwithopen("test.csv","wt",newline='')ascsvfile...
两种解决方法:python3 csv writerow 写入文件多空行 前言 如示例,用csv writerow写入文件,会发现每写入一行,便多一个空行。而我们可能并不需要这些空行。 本文提供2种解决方法:newline=” 和 lineterminator=’\n’。 示例 import csv csvData = [['Person', 'Age'], ['Peter', '22'], ['Jasmine', ...